The new owner of The Manchester Screen says it is “the largest combined banner and digital billboard in the UK” (Marcomm News)
Already known as the second-largest digital outdoor billboard in Europe, The Manchester Screen wraps around the Victoria Warehouse in Salford Quays, capturing more than 21.6 million annual impressions from City Centre, MediaCity and football traffic. […]
marcommnews.com
Thu, Nov 13 at 10:22 PM
Thu, Nov 13 at 10:22 PM